Share My Information: If you would like someone to view, discuss and or make a payment on your account, please consider the following below.

Setting up FERPA Designee: Student creates a 4-digit pin for parents/guardians who wish to contact our office to discuss student financial information.

Becoming an Authorized User: Allows parents and guardians to login to the Flywire payment portal to make a payment, enroll in a payment plan & download an invoice.

Setting up Delegate User: Student grants access to parent and or guardians to view the fee bill and 1098-T Form in Student Admin.

Payment Plans (Fall & Spring Only): Students may enroll in a 3, 4 or 5-month payment plan. Please note the Fall 5-month payment plan option closes July 15th, the Spring 5-month payment plan closes on December 15th and will not reopen for the semester. To avoid receiving up to $300 in late fees, please enroll in a payment plan by the fee bill due date. For more information on payment plans, please click the link below.

Wire Transfers (International Payments): Please wire payment 2-4 weeks before the fee bill due date to ensure receipt by the due date and to avoid receiving up to $300 in late fees.  UConn DOES NOT give out banking information and we can only track payments made through Flywire and Convera.

Third Party Invoicing: If a student is expecting their tuition and fee bill to be paid directly to UConn by a third party ( i.e. employer, sponsor, state agency, etc.), the student must submit a third-party financial guarantee guaranteed letter on company letterhead to the Office of the Bursar through the link below.
